Font Pairing Tips with Couture Script

One of the best things about Couture Script is how well it pairs with other typefaces. For a recent website header, I combined it with a clean sans serif for the subheading. The contrast between the flowing script and the crisp sans serif created a visual hierarchy that guided the eye naturally. I’ve also used it alongside serif fonts for print-style layouts and with other Script Handwritten fonts for multi-layered quote graphics. Just remember: let Couture Script be the star. Use it for headlines, not body text.

Readability Considerations for Mobile and Thumbnail Use

I learned early on that not all Script Handwritten fonts are mobile-friendly. Couture Script surprised me with how well it holds up in small sizes—especially when used with high contrast. I always test it in thumbnail previews and Instagram story layouts. The trick is to use it for short phrases and avoid overloading it with too many strokes or background elements. On dark backgrounds, I slightly increase the font weight or add a subtle outline to ensure legibility.
